89:10 NKJV
逐节对照
  • New King James Version - You have broken Rahab in pieces, as one who is slain; You have scattered Your enemies with Your mighty arm.
  • 新标点和合本 - 你打碎了拉哈伯,似乎是已杀的人; 你用有能的膀臂打散了你的仇敌。
  • 和合本2010(上帝版-简体) - 你打碎了拉哈伯 ,使它如遭刺杀的人; 你用大能的膀臂打散了你的仇敌。
  • 和合本2010(神版-简体) - 你打碎了拉哈伯 ,使它如遭刺杀的人; 你用大能的膀臂打散了你的仇敌。
  • 当代译本 - 你击碎海怪 ,使其毙命, 以大能的臂膀驱散仇敌。
  • 圣经新译本 - 你打碎了拉哈伯,好像已遭刺杀的人; 你用有力的膀臂,赶散了你的仇敌。
  • 中文标准译本 - 是你压碎拉哈伯,使它如同被刺透的人; 你用大力的膀臂打散你的仇敌。
  • 现代标点和合本 - 你打碎了拉哈伯,似乎是已杀的人, 你用有能的膀臂打散了你的仇敌。
  • 和合本(拼音版) - 你打碎了拉哈伯,似乎是已杀的人。 你用有能的膀臂打散了你的仇敌。
  • New International Version - You crushed Rahab like one of the slain; with your strong arm you scattered your enemies.
  • New International Reader's Version - You crushed Egypt and killed her people. With your powerful arm you scattered your enemies.
  • English Standard Version - You crushed Rahab like a carcass; you scattered your enemies with your mighty arm.
  • New Living Translation - You crushed the great sea monster. You scattered your enemies with your mighty arm.
  • Christian Standard Bible - You crushed Rahab like one who is slain; you scattered your enemies with your powerful arm.
  • New American Standard Bible - You Yourself crushed Rahab like one who is slain; You scattered Your enemies with Your mighty arm.
  • Amplified Bible - You have crushed Rahab (Egypt) like one who is slain; You have scattered Your enemies with Your mighty arm.
  • American Standard Version - Thou hast broken Rahab in pieces, as one that is slain; Thou hast scattered thine enemies with the arm of thy strength.
  • King James Version - Thou hast broken Rahab in pieces, as one that is slain; thou hast scattered thine enemies with thy strong arm.
  • New English Translation - You crushed the Proud One and killed it; with your strong arm you scattered your enemies.
  • World English Bible - You have broken Rahab in pieces, like one of the slain. You have scattered your enemies with your mighty arm.
